Front-load vs Roll off Dumpsters
Front -load and roll-off dumpsters have distinct designs that make them useful in various manners. Understanding more about them will enable you to choose an option that is right for your job.
Front-load DumpstersFront-load dumpsters have mechanical arms that may lift heavy objects. This is a convenient option for projects that contain lots of heavy items like appliances and concrete. In addition , they are good for emptying commercial dumpsters like the kind eateries use.
Roll off DumpstersRoll off dumpsters are usually the right option for commercial and residential projects like repairing a roof, remodeling a basement, or including a room to your house. They have doors that swing open, letting you walk into the dumpster. Additionally they have open tops that let you throw debris into the container. Rental firms will generally leave a roll-off dumpster at your job location for many days or weeks. This is a convenient option for both little and large projects.
20 yard dumpster dimensions in Canal Point
A 20 yard dumpster can carry about 20 cubic yards of waste or debris. Ordinary dimensions for a 20 yard container are about 22 feet long by 8 feet wide by 4.5 feet high. With these dimensions, a 20 yard dumpster can carry about 10 pickup truck loads of debris and waste. This means that the 20-yarder is a common size for occupations that involve clean-up from bigger projects. Because of its compact size that still has capacity for a good volume of debris, a 20 yard container is just one of typically the most popular dumpster sizes for house jobs. Examples of what can fit in a 20 yard container include:
- Clean-Up from a basement, attic or garage
- Flooring and carpet removal from a big house
- 300 to 400 square feet of deck removal
- 2,500 to 3,000 square feet of shingle removal from a single layer roof

Construction Dumpster Rental in Canal Point - Do You Need One?
Although local governments frequently provide waste disposal services, not many of them will haul away construction debris. This makes it important for individuals to rent dumpsters for them to dispose of waste during construction jobs.
The most common exception to this rule is when you've got a truck that is large enough to transport all construction debris to a landfill or landfill drop off point. If you're working on a tiny bathroom remodeling job, for instance, you may find you could fit all of the debris in a truck bed.
Other than quite small jobs, it is strongly recommended that you rent a dumpster in Canal Point for construction jobs.
If you aren't certain whether your municipality accepts construction debris, contact the city for more advice. You will probably discover that you will have to rent a dumpster in Canal Point. Setting debris out for garbage removal could possibly result in fines.
Security Recommendations for Renting a Dumpster
Follow these recommendations to remain safe while using a rental dumpster.
1. Engage the rear wheel locks when you park the dumpster on an incline. Even a small incline could induce it to roll.
2. Do not overfill the dumpster. Things should not stick out of the top opening.
3. Use caution when opening the dumpster door, and ensure you lock it when you are finished.
4. Wear safety gloves to protect your hands while loading debris.
5. A back support brace can help prevent injuries while taking heavy things to the dumpster.
6. Just let adults close to the dumpster.
7. Never put chemicals in the dumpster. Once they enter the landfill, they could leak out and contaminate your local ground water.
8. Be sure to have lots of light when moving debris to the dumpster. If your plan is to work at twilight, get a light that provides enough illumination.

What's the largest size dumpster available?
The largest roll off dumpster that businesses generally rent is a 40 yard container. This huge dumpster will hold up to 40 cubic yards of debris, which is comparable to between 12 and 20 pickup truck loads of debris.
The weight limit on 40 yard containers typically ranges from 4 to 8 tons (8,000 to 16,000 pounds). Be very mindful of the limit and do your best not to surpass it. Should you go over the limit, you can incur overage costs, which add up fast.
Examples of projects that a 40 yard container will likely be the right size for include: A foreclosure or estate cleanout A 750 square foot deck removal 4,000 square feet of roofing shingles in multiple layers Whole-dwelling interior renovation Getting rid of trash when you're moving in or out House demolition New house construction Commercial and residential cleanouts
What's the lowest size dumpster accessible?
The lowest size roll off dumpster normally accessible is 10 yards. This container will carry about 10 cubic yards of waste and debris, which is approximately equivalent to 3 to 5 pickup truck loads of waste. This dumpster is a great option for small-scale jobs, like modest house cleanouts.
Other examples of jobs that a 10 yard container would function nicely for include: A garage, shed or loft cleanout A 250 square foot deck removal 2,000 to 2,500 square feet of single layer roofing shingles A modest kitchen or bathroom remodeling project Concrete or dirt removal Getting rid of rubbish Bear in mind that weight limitations for the containers are imposed, thus exceeding the weight limit will incur additional charges. The standard weight limitation for a 10 yard bin is 1 to 3 tons (2,000 to 6,000 pounds).
A 10 yard bin can help you take care of small jobs around the house. If you have a bigger project coming up, take a look at some bigger containers too.

Some Things You Can Not Put into Your Dumpster
Although the special rules that control what you can and cannot contain in a dumpster vary from area to area, there are several kinds of substances that most construction dumpster rentals service in Canal Points WOn't enable. A number of the things which you typically cannot place in the dumpster contain:
Batteries, particularly the kind that contain mercury Automotive fluids like used motor oil, engine coolants, and transmission fluid Pesticides and herbicides that could pollute groundwater Paints and solvents (they include oils and other chemicals that can harm the environment) Electronics, especially those that comprise batteries There are likewise some mattresses that you can normally place in your dumpster so long as you are willing to pay an additional fee. Included in these are: Appliances Mattresses Tires
When in doubt, it's better to get in touch with your rental company to get a listing of things that you just can not place into the dumpster.
10 yard dumpster measurements in Canal Point
A 10 yard dumpster is made to carry 10 cubic yards of waste and debris. A 10 yard dumpster will measure approximately 12 feet long by 8 feet wide by four feet high, although exact container sizes will change with different firms.
It might be difficult to choose just the container size you will need for your house endeavor, but a 10 yard dumpster works well for smaller clean-up occupations. To give you an idea, a 10 yard dumpster would carry:
- Debris cleanout from a basement or garage A 250 square foot deck that's been removed
- A single layer of 1,500 square feet of roof shingles
- The debris from a small kitchen or bathroom remodeling job
If your job is big enough that you do not have room in your truck to haul everything to the dump, but small enough that you do not desire an enormous container, a 10 yard dumpster should work flawlessly.
